Liftwright is the elevator-dispatch simulator used by the Calloway Towers modeling team; its admin account controls scenario seeds and dispatch-algorithm weights. For the security reviewer: recovery requires two steps. First, confirm the requester appears on the simulator owners roster and that the lockout was not triggered by repeated failed logins from an unrecognized host. Second, initiate recovery from the ops console, which invalidates all active sessions. The console then asks for the account recovery passphrase, reproduced below.

vault phrase of tawip-faweg = fraok-holdor-zorwyn-belox-ulador-aldix-quenael-lamox-juleth-lamion

Subject: Cut-over summary — consent banner, Bramblehook prod

Hi — wrapping up the cut-over for review. We switched Bramblehook's consent banner from the legacy modal to the inline variant at 09:00, drained the old cache tier, and verified opt-out persistence across both regions. No rollbacks needed. For your review, the configuration now active in production is as follows.

config for tawif-bagef:
[sorwyn]
team = sorys
access_code = ac_9ba40c
host = sorwyn.ordingrid.local
port = 5000
owner = aldok.quenion
peer = belath.paliqcloud.local

## Changelog 4.2.0 — ExportWell defaults changed

Retry behavior for failed exports is now on by default. Previously, a failed export to the Corvid archive sat in the dead-letter queue until manually requeued. Now: three automatic retries with exponential backoff, then dead-letter. Max payload for retried jobs dropped to 200 MB; larger jobs fail fast. If you joined after 4.1, ignore older docs telling you to requeue by hand — that path is removed. New installations ship with the default configuration shown below.

deployment values, yadug-bawif:
[framir]
team = pelox
access_code = ac_a38ab2
owner = tamion.julael
host = framir.tolvaqlabs.test
port = 11211
peer = tammir.zemvargrid.local
salt = 2215ef03
pin = 1541